PLEASE HELP!! Which describes the graph of y = (x + 7)^2 - 9?

Mathematics
1 answer:
mezya [45]2 years ago
5 0

Answer:

The answer is D. Vertex at (-7,-9).

Step-by-step explanation:

The equation is in vertex form, so you take the opposite of x and the constant stays the same. So, the opposite of 7 is -7 and -9 stays the same.

What is the logarithmic form of the solution to 102t = 9?
Harman [31]

Equivalent equations are equations that have the same value

The equation in logarithmic form is t = \frac{\log(9)}{2}

<h3>How to rewrite the equation</h3>

The expression is given as:

10^{2t} = 9

Take the logarithm of both sides

\log(10^{2t}) = \log(9)

Apply the power rule of logarithm

2t\log(10) = \log(9)

Divide both sides by log(10)

2t = \frac{\log(9)}{\log(10)}

Apply change of base rule

2t = \log_{10}(9)

Divide both sides by 2

t = \frac{\log_{10}(9)}{2}

Rewrite as:

t = \frac{\log(9)}{2}

Hence, the equation in logarithmic form is t = \frac{\log(9)}{2}
